Checklist
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Log sell through by account for the first eight weeks.
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Record the arrival condition with photographs on the day of delivery.
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.

Frequently asked questions
How should used Destiny Air units be disposed of?
Through designated battery or electronics collection points, never in general household waste.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
Is documentation provided for customs?
Commercial invoice, packing list and the relevant certificates are supplied; the importer's broker handles the declaration.
